Subject: Metrics sidecar rollout — what you'll inherit

Hey folks,

Quick note for whoever maintains this later: the Tallyfin sidecar now aggregates partner metrics before shipping them upstream, so per-pod scrape configs are gone. If counters look halved, check the sidecar's flush interval first — that's bitten us twice. Everything's documented in the Tallyfin runbook. The sidecar pulls its aggregation config using the bearer token below.

session JWT of yawep-yawep = eyJhbGciOiJIUzI1NiIsInR5cCI6IkpXVCJ9.eyJzdWIiOiI3pWF3_In0.aXYsHiog

// Broker upgrade notes for plugin authors:
// Quillbus 4.x replaces the legacy 3.x wire protocol. Plugins must
// construct the client with explicit protocol negotiation enabled,
// or connections to the Larkfield cluster will be silently downgraded
// and dropped after 30s. Topic names are unchanged. For local testing
// against the sandbox broker, authenticate with the key below.

API key for bafof-bagaf: qvz2-qi

**Minutes — Management Meeting, Varenhold Ltd.**

Present: M. Oakes, T. Brill, S. Fenwick. We agreed the Glimmerline accessory range has run its course — sales have been flat since the Torvale launch and margins keep shrinking. Retirement begins next quarter, with stock sell-through by spring. Support winds down over six months. Tara will handle the customer comms. Full rationale for the board follows below.

board note of kagep-yahig: Only 9 of the 120 pilot accounts renewed Quenix, so a churn review is set for April 1.

# Broker upgrade notes — Corvane Hub 5.x
# For external plugin authors: this env file targets the upgraded
# broker. Legacy 4.x plugins must set BROKER_PROTOCOL=amqp-v2 or
# connections will be refused. Heartbeat interval is now mandatory
# (BROKER_HEARTBEAT=30). Plugins authenticate with the broker using
# the credential defined on the next line.

env line for fafof-fahag: LEDGER_TOKEN5=f8790